annotate nextstep/AUTHORS @ 100274:c431d4325972

* termchar.h (struct tty): New members termcap_term_buffer and termcap_strings_buffer. * term.c (encode_terminal_code): Free any previous memory blocks before calling xmalloc for encode_terminal_src or encode_terminal_dst. (maybe_fatal): Buffer argument deleted. Don't free buffer here. All callers changed. (init_tty): Store termcap data and string buffers in new struct tty members termcap_term_buffer and termcap_strings_buffer. (delete_tty): Free them. (syms_of_term): Initialize encode_terminal_src and encode_terminal_dst.
author Chong Yidong <cyd@stupidchicken.com>
date Mon, 08 Dec 2008 14:43:45 +0000
parents d47ff67f1a11
children f5a478bc42bc
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
96675
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
1 In addition to the folks listed in ../AUTHORS responsible for GNU Emacs itself,
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
2 the NeXTstep port owes to the following people:
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
3
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
4 Carl Edman
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
5 original author and maintainer, mainly UI
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
6 Michael Brouwer
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
7 heavy contributor, input handling and other areas
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
8 Christian Limpach
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
9 help / maintenance on NeXTstep
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
10 Scott Bender
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
11 OpenStep, Rhapsody ports
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
12 Christophe de Dinechin
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
13 MacOS X port
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
14 Adrian Robert
99548
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
15 GNUstep port, update Emacs 20 -> 21+
96675
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
16
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
17 Joe Reiss
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
18 popup menu, dialog boxes; icons
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
19 Andrew Athan
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
20 font panel integration
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
21 Scott Byer
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
22 improved rendering code
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
23 Scott Hess
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
24 keyboard handling suggestions
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
25
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
26 Rahul Abrol
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
27 "hide others" patch
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
28 Adam Ratcliffe
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
29 preferences panel documentation
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
30 Peter Dyballa
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
31 assistance with non-ASCII rendering and keyboard handling
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
32 David M. Cooke
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
33 fix to XPM crash bug
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
34 Carsten Bormann
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
35 initial patch and assistance getting dired working for non-ASCII filenames
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
36 Andrew Moore
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
37 assistance on ns-mark-nav extension
d45acf0c8d23 merging Emacs.app (NeXTstep port)
Adrian Robert <Adrian.B.Robert@gmail.com>
parents:
diff changeset
38
99548
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
39 The GNUstep port was made possible through the assistance of Adam
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
40 Fedor, Fred Kiefer, M. Uli Klusterer, Alexander Malmberg, Jonas
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
41 Matton, and Riccardo Mottola. Leigh Smith maintained the SourceForge
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
42 project for a period.
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
43
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
44 Suggestions from Darcy Brockbank, Timothy Bissell, Scott Byer, David
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
45 Griffiths, Scott Hess, Eberhard Mandler, John C. Randolph, and Bradley
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
46 Taylor all helped things along at one point or another. Axel Seibert
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
47 <seiberta@@informatik.tu-muenchen.de> and Paul J. Sanchez
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
48 <paul@@whimsy.umsl.edu> offered their time and machines to make a
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
49 binary release possible.
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
50
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
51 We would also like to thank a number of people who kept up the
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
52 constant supply of bug reports, suggested features and praise: Hardy
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
53 Mayer, Gisli Ottarsson, Anthony Heading, David Bau, Jamie Zawinski,
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
54 Martin Moncrieffe, Simson L. Garfinkel, Richard Stallman, Stephen
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
55 Anderson, Ivo Welch, Magnus Nordborg, Tom Epperly, Andreas Koenig,
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
56 Yves Arrouye, Anil Somayaji, Gregor Hoffleit; and the few hundred
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
57 other people on the mailing list from whom we didn't hear much, but
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
58 the presence of which assured us that maybe this project was actually
d47ff67f1a11 Updated with additional credits, from ns-emacs.texi.
Chong Yidong <cyd@stupidchicken.com>
parents: 96675
diff changeset
59 worth doing.